News: Slam Dunk Festival announces first wave of acts for 2024

  • October 25, 2023
  • Izzy Clayton
Total
0
Shares
0
0
0

Slam Dunk Festival has today announced the first list of acts performing at next years festival taking place at Hatfield Park on Saturday, May 25 and Leeds Temple Newsam Park on Sunday, May 26. 

Headlining the event is You Me At Six and All American Rejects with YMAS frontman Josh Franceschi quoted as saying:

“Looking forward to returning to Slam Dunk this year to headline the festival. Slam Dunk has given You Me At Six so much over our career and we’ve got a lot of special memories from performing there over the years. The line-up is stacked with great artists, so will be an elite one.”

This will be the first time All American Rejects have performed in the UK for 10 years and they will be joined by the likes of I Prevail, Waterparks, The Interrupters and many more.
